Can someone clarify the rough timeline for an ERJ hopeful starting training in Nov?
Starting w/ CTP/ATP first week in Nov. Then after Indoc (starting 3rd week) would mean ground school starting 4th week in Nov till 2nd week in Dec. Sims in DEN until end of Dec?
Anyone know what to expect for Thanksgiving, Christmas, or New Years if anything?
I know everyone's timeline may differ by a week or so, but I was told to expect 3 months of training from INDOC on... That seems like a very long timeline. Nov to end of Jan 2022 and maybe be reserve in February?
Starting w/ CTP/ATP first week in Nov. Then after Indoc (starting 3rd week) would mean ground school starting 4th week in Nov till 2nd week in Dec. Sims in DEN until end of Dec?
Anyone know what to expect for Thanksgiving, Christmas, or New Years if anything?
I know everyone's timeline may differ by a week or so, but I was told to expect 3 months of training from INDOC on... That seems like a very long timeline. Nov to end of Jan 2022 and maybe be reserve in February?
Started Indoc first week of Nov and had my checkride Jan 8 - with weekends off, week off between ground and procedures and then another week off between procedures and sims. Everyone's times will be different after ground school as your procedures and sims schedules will vary.

I have the same timeline as you for the ERJ.
From the previous posts and recent training experiences i have gathered a rough timeline, maybe someone can chime in and rectify if needed.
Nov 8th - 14th ATP/CTP Dallas
-Week Off-
Nov 22nd INDOC starts but heard it's (tue-tue) so Nov 23rd - Nov 30th
*Btw not sure if INDOC is still virtual from home or will have to be in Denver so if someone can fill in?
Rest of the week off again
Followed by 10 days of ground (Mon-Fri) and weekends off.
Ground timeline 6th Dec - 17th Dec
Followed by Sim (15 days with 5-9 days off in between)
So expect to get off somewhere in Mid Jan.
P.s good question about the new year holidays in between. I have no clue but maybe calling skywest travel we can get a better picture.

Don't call the travel department about that as thats not what they do. That is a question for the training department. And they might not even really say. The only time you will really know your schedule is when you bid for sim slots during ground. Then your slot will show you if you have the holiday off or not. If I had to guess the actual days of thanksgiving and Christmas will be off, but only those. Which would make it pretty hard to go home and come back within 24 hours. And its possible that they will still run the training on the holidays becasue they have to keep people moving. When I went through training my differences class was on July 4th even though its a company holiday.
